How did the labor movement impact labor laws and worker rights?

The labor movement played a significant role in shaping labor laws and advancing worker rights, resulting in improvements such as the establishment of minimum wage laws, the right to collective bargaining, and workplace safety regulations. What were the main outcomes of the 2016 U.S. presidential election?

The main outcomes of the 2016 U.S. presidential election included Donald Trump winning the presidency over Hillary Clinton, Republican control of both the Senate and House of Representatives, and the emergence of new political divides and conversations across the country.
